Lee Johns, PMP, has extensive experience in project management and engineering within the energy sector, currently serving as Superintendent of Fleet Projects Oversight at Entergy since August 2018. In this role, Lee formulates and executes business strategies to improve fleet project performance while fostering collaboration with engineering management. Previously, Lee held various positions at American Electric Power (AEP) for over a decade, including Engineering Project Manager Principal, where impactful capital initiatives and risk management strategies were implemented. Other roles at AEP included Technical Training Supervisor and General Supervisor of Chemistry, focusing on training program efficacy and system reliability. Lee's earlier career includes significant experience at Progress Energy, Consumers Energy, and military service in the United States Army National Guard and Navy, with a background in artillery, combat engineering, and aircrew operations. An alumnus of Campbell University, Lee holds a Bachelor's degree in Applied Science, Business Management, and Administration.
